Author Topic: Ancestris prend 25% des ressources processeur !!!  (Read 7158 times)

0 Members and 1 Guest are viewing this topic.

Offline fred_76

  • VIP
  • Full Member
  • *
  • Posts: 42
    • View Profile
Ancestris prend 25% des ressources processeur !!!
« on: December 06, 2023, 22:06:46 »
Bonjour

Je m'étonnais d'entendre le ventilateur de mon PC accélérer quand j'utilisais Ancestris. J'ai alors regardé les ressources qu'il prenait et j'ai été très surpris de voir qu'il prenait entre 20 et 25% (parfois 30%) des ressources processeur à lui tout seul, sans rien faire.

Je ne sais pas quel module a besoin d'autant de ressources dans Ancestris.

Version d'Ancestris :  12.0.12236
Java :  21+35-LTS - C:\Program Files\Eclipse Adoptium\jre-21.0.0.35-hotspot
Système :  Windows 11 - 10.0 - ASUS

Ma base de données a 3179 individus, dans un seul groupe familial. J'utilise l'affichage Nimbus, avec à gauche l'arbre dynamique, et à droite la fenètre Cygnus. Rien de plus.

Si je change le mode d'affichage en apparence Standard ou Métal, c'est pareil.

Même quand aucune base n'est chargée, Ancestris prend toujours autant de ressources... ce n'est pas normal.

Il doit y avoir une fuite quelque part dans le code qui provoque cet emballement.

Mon PC :
Processeur Intel(R) Core(TM) i7-8750H CPU @ 2.20GHz, 2208 MHz, 6 cœur(s), 12 processeur(s) logique(s)
Mémoire physique (RAM) installée 32.0 Go
OS Microsoft Windows 11 Famille Unilingue
Version 10.0.22621 Build 22621


A+

Fred
« Last Edit: December 06, 2023, 22:10:39 by fred_76 »

Offline Zurga

  • VIP
  • Supernatural Member
  • *
  • Posts: 4 479
    • View Profile
Re : Ancestris prend 25% des ressources processeur !!!
« Reply #1 on: December 06, 2023, 22:08:34 »
Mettez Java 17 et dites nous si c'est pareil.
Dans mes tests, il semble que Java 21 donne des résultats étranges en terme d'utilisation CPU.

Zurga

Offline fred_76

  • VIP
  • Full Member
  • *
  • Posts: 42
    • View Profile
Re: Ancestris prend 25% des ressources processeur !!!
« Reply #2 on: December 06, 2023, 22:18:59 »
Effectivement c'est passé à 2-5% en changeant la version de Java, et même 0% quand je ne touche plus à rien.

Version d'Ancestris :  12.0.12236
Java :  17.0.9+11-LTS-201 - C:\Program Files\Java\jdk-17
Système :  Windows 11 - 10.0 - ASUS
Répertoire utilisateur :  C:\Users\ASUS\.ancestris\trunk

Mon ventilateur apprécie :-)

Merci

A+

Fred
« Last Edit: December 06, 2023, 22:21:57 by fred_76 »

Offline fred_76

  • VIP
  • Full Member
  • *
  • Posts: 42
    • View Profile
Re: Ancestris prend 25% des ressources processeur !!!
« Reply #3 on: December 07, 2023, 19:06:43 »
Bonsoir

Ça serait bien de préciser dans la page d’aide :
https://docs.ancestris.org/books/mode-demploi/page/installation-de-java

que même si Ancestris est compatible avec la version 21 de Java, il est préférable d’utiliser la version 17, plus stable.

Il faudrait aussi recommander de ne plus installer la version 8 de Java, qui n’est plus trop maintenue…

A+

Fred
« Last Edit: December 07, 2023, 19:09:02 by fred_76 »

Offline Zurga

  • VIP
  • Supernatural Member
  • *
  • Posts: 4 479
    • View Profile
Re: Ancestris prend 25% des ressources processeur !!!
« Reply #4 on: December 07, 2023, 21:23:55 »
Java 8 est toujours maintenu : https://www.java.com/fr/download/java8_update.jsp

Mais ce n'est pas forcément la version la plus intéressante actuellement.
Tant qu'on n'aura pas sorti la version 12 de manière officielle, c'est difficile de déconseiller Java 8 alors que c'est la version qui est incluse dans l'installateur Windows de la version 11.

Zurga